Amazingly dr heywood floyd, middleaged in the first two books, is still going strong aged one hundred and three, thanks to half a lifetime spent in low gravity, orbiting earth. Floyd is chosen as one of a handful of celebrity guests to witness the first manned touchdown on the surface of halleys comet on the privatelyowned spaceship universe.
